Japan and China Join Forces for More Anime Projects

Gojo and Naruto

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

In a significant development, Japan and China have announced a series of agreements aimed at enhancing cultural ties through increased anime co-productions. This initiative, revealed in December 2024, marks a new era of collaboration between the two nations in the entertainment sector.

The agreements were formalized during a meeting between the foreign ministers of Japan and China, Takeshi Iwaya and Wang Yi, respectively. This meeting underscored the mutual interest in fostering closer cultural and entertainment relations, with a particular focus on the anime industry.

The series of agreements includes ten key points designed to strengthen cultural exchanges and cooperation. Among these, the promotion of joint anime productions stands out as a central element. This strategic move aims to leverage the strengths of both countries’ anime industries, combining Japan’s rich history in anime production with China’s growing market and technological advancements.

The collaboration is expected to result in a diverse range of anime projects that appeal to audiences in both countries and internationally. By pooling resources and expertise, Japan and China aim to create content that reflects their shared cultural narratives while introducing innovative storytelling techniques.
